> I'm displaying a lots of same elements in my application (e.g. I have 200 > same images or 200 text elements with same value). Each element consumes > same amount of memory. > > Is there a way to create only one template element but render and show many > of these elements using that template element as a pattern (or something > similar) in order to reduce memory consumption? Hmm, well in the 'hack' arena you might look at using markers. Define the repeated content as a marker and then set that marker on a path that consists of nothing but moveto commands (d="M 10,10 M20,30 ..."). Using markers can be a bit tricky but there are some examples in the samples/test/spec/painting directory.
